Jindal Saw

Jindal Saw Ltd., a prominent player in the steel and pipe manufacturing industry, is headquartered in India. Established in 1984, the company has grown to become a leader in the production of a diverse range of products, including steel pipes, tubes, and fittings, primarily serving the oil and gas, water, and infrastructure sectors. With major operational regions across India and international markets, Jindal Saw is renowned for its innovative manufacturing processes and commitment to quality. The company’s core offerings, such as large diameter pipes and seamless tubes, are distinguished by their durability and precision engineering. Jindal Saw's strategic position in the market is underscored by its significant achievements, including certifications for quality and environmental management, which reinforce its reputation as a trusted supplier in the global marketplace.

Jindal Saw's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, Jindal Saw reported significant carbon emissions, with Scope 1 emissions totalling approximately 1,100,169,720 kg CO2e and Scope 2 emissions at about 323,328,180 kg CO2e. This resulted in a combined total of approximately 1,423,497,900 kg CO2e for the year. The company has not disclosed any Scope 3 emissions data. In 2022, Jindal Saw's emissions were slightly higher, with Scope 1 emissions at about 1,187,793,530 kg CO2e and Scope 2 emissions at approximately 298,268,540 kg CO2e, leading to a total of around 1,486,062,070 kg CO2e. For 2024, while specific emissions data is not available, the company has reported emission intensity metrics. The total Scope 1 and Scope 2 emission intensity per crore rupee of turnover is approximately 0.010935 kg CO2e, and in terms of physical output, it stands at about 1,140 kg CO2e per tonne. Despite these figures, Jindal Saw has not set any specific reduction targets or climate pledges, indicating a potential area for improvement in their climate commitments. The absence of disclosed reduction initiatives suggests that the company may need to enhance its strategies to address carbon emissions effectively.
